Note: The milliequivalent (mEq) is the unit of measure often used for electrolytes. It indicates the chemical activity, or combining power, of an element relative to the activity of 1 mg of hydrogen. Thus, 1 mEq is represented by 1 mg of hydrogen (1 mole) or 23 mg of Na+, 39 mg of K+, etc. a As phosphorus, inorganic.If serum potassium decreases to <3.3 mEq/L during DKA treatment, insulin should be stopped and potassium administered intravenously. Potassium Citrate Er is a generic medication; Urocit-K 5 is the brand version of Potassium Citrate Er. Potassium is often referred to in amounts of milliequivalents (mEq) or milligrams (mg). For conversion, 1 milliequivalent is equal to 39.09 milligrams of potassium. Potassium supplements will come with a warning if …A healthy adult should aim to consume 3,500-4,700 mg daily from foods. For healthy adults, the World Health Organization recommends potassium intake of at least 90 mEq/day (3510 mg), while the 2015 Dietary Guidelines for Americans recommends 120 mEq/day (4700 mg). coach t classic 2023 To change mg of elemental potassium to mEq, take mg and divide it by 39.0983 (atomic weight of potassium). For example, 90 mg is equivalent to 2.30 mEq, 99 mg is equivalent to 2.53 mEq. Is potassium chloride 20 mEq over-the-counter?
